District Charter Applicant: Letter of Intent

District charter applicants must submit a Letter of Intent (LOI) with requested accompanying information to the Ouachita Parish School Board. The LOI must be received no later than 4:00 pm CST on Friday, March 2, 2018. LOIs should be completed using this form, saved as a single PDF file along will all necessary documents and submit via email to .

All applicants are required to submit a Letter of Intent (LOI) prior to submitting a completed application. This Letter of Intent will provide formal notice to the Ouachita Parish School Board that the organization listed below intends to submit a charter school application.

All information presented in this LOI is non-binding.
